Novels Cervantes's novels, listed chronologically, are as follows:
La Galatea (1585), a pastoral romance in prose and verse based upon the genre introduced into Spain by Jorge de Montemayor's Diana (1559). Its theme is the fortunes and misfortunes in love of a numbepherdesses, who spend their life singing and playing musical instruments.
El ingenioso hidalgo don Quijote de la Mancha (1605): First volume of Don Quixote.
Novelas ejemplares (1613), a collection of twelve short stories of varied types about the social, political, and historical problems of Cervantes' Spain:
La gitanilla (The Gypsy Girl) El amante liberal (The Generous Lover) Rinconete y Cortadillo La española inglesa (The English Spanish Lady) El licenciado Vidriera (The Lawyer of Glass) La fuerza de la sangre (The Power of Blood) El celoso extremeño (The Jealous Old Man From Extremadura) La ilustre fregona (The Illustrious Kitchen-Maid) Novela de las dos doncellas (The Two Damsels) Novela de la señora Cornelia (Lady Cornelia) Novela del casamiento engañoso (The Deceitful Marriage) El coloquio de los perros (The Dialogue of the Dogs)
Segunda parte del ingenioso hidalgo don Quijote de la Mancha (1615): Second volume of Don Quixote.
Los trabajos de Persiles y Segismunda (1617). Los trabajos is the best evidence not only of the survival of Byzantine novel themes but also of the survival of forms and ideas of the Spanish novel of the second Renaissance. In this work, published after the author's death, Cervantes relates the ideal love and unbelievable vicissitudes of a couple who, starting from the Arctic regions, arrive in Rome, where they find a happy ending for their complicated adventures.
